JCI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

1,238 of the 7,459 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Johnson Controls International (JCI)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$47.9B — up 0.65% from $47.6B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 147 funds opened new JCI positions and 90 closed out — a net gain of 57 holders — while 509 added to existing stakes and 397 trimmed.

The largest buyer was DZ Bank, adding an estimated $247M. The largest seller was Dodge & Cox, cutting an estimated $785M.
